Abstract

Official abstract text for this publication.

A separator includes an inorganic particle layer including an inorganic particle, a polymeric binder and a fiber substance. A mass ratio of the fiber substance with respect to a total mass of the inorganic particle, the polymeric binder and the fiber substance is 0.1 mass % or more and 40 mass % or less.

First claim

Opening claim text (preview).

What is claimed is: 1. A secondary battery comprising: a positive electrode containing a positive electrode active material; a negative electrode containing a negative electrode active material; a separator disposed at least between the positive electrode and the negative electrode; and an aqueous electrolyte, wherein the separator comprises an inorganic particle layer including an inorganic particle, a polymeric binder and a fiber substance, the fiber substance is hydrophilic and a mass ratio of the fiber substance with respect to a total mass of the inorganic particle, the polymeric binder and the fiber substance is 0.1 mass % or more and 40 mass % or less, and a mass ratio of the polymeric binder with respect to a total mass of the inorganic particle, the polymeric binder and the fiber substance is 5 mass % or more and 30 mass % or less. 2. The secondary battery according to claim 1 , wherein the mass ratio of the fiber substance is 0.5 mass % or more and 30 mass % or less. 3. The secondary battery according to claim 1 , wherein an average fiber diameter of the fiber substance is 1 nm or more and 100 nm or less. 4. The secondary battery according to claim 1 , wherein the separator further comprises a porous free-standing film disposed on a main surface of the inorganic particle layer. 5. The secondary battery according to claim 1 , wherein the inorganic particle include at least one of NASICON type LATP (Li 1+x Al x Ti 2−x (PO 4 ) 3 ), Li 1+x Al x Ge 2−x (PO 4 ) 3 , Li 1+x Al x Zr 2−x (PO 4 ) 3 (0.1≤x≤0.5), amorphous LIPON (Li 2.9 PO 3.3 N 0.46 ), or garnet type LLZ (Li 7 La 3 Zr 2 O 12 ). 6. The secondary battery according to claim 1 , wherein the polymeric binder includes a part composed of a monomer unit comprising a hydrocarbon having a functional group containing at least one element selected from the group consisting of oxygen (O), sulfur (S), nitrogen (N), and fluorine (F), and a ratio of the part composed of the monomer unit is 70 mol % or more. 7. The secondary battery according to claim 1 , wherein the negative electrode active material includes a compound having a lithium ion adsorption/desorption potential of 1 V or more and 3 V or less (vs. Li/Li + ) as a potential based on metal lithium. 8. The secondary battery according to claim 1 , wherein the positive electrode active material includes a compound having a lithium ion adsorption/desorption potential of 2.5 V or more and 5.5 V or less (vs. Li/Li + ) as a potential based on metal lithium. 9. A battery pack comprising the secondary battery according to claim 1 . 10. The battery pack according to claim 9 , further comprising an external terminal for energization and a protection circuit. 11. The battery pack according to claim 9 , comprising a plurality of the secondary batteries, wherein the plurality of secondary batteries are electrically connected in series, in parallel, or in combination of series and parallel. 12. A vehicle comprising the battery pack according to claim 9 . 13. A stationary power supply comprising the battery pack according to claim 9 . 14. The secondary battery according to claim 1 , wherein the fiber substance is selected from the group consisting of cellulose fibers, polysaccharides, and polyvinyl alcohol.
